STM32与Protues仿真实例:电子钟的制作与实践
版权申诉
45 浏览量
更新于2024-10-16
收藏 17KB ZIP 举报
资源摘要信息:"基于STM32的Protues仿真实例(8051)-电子钟"
1. STM32微控制器与8051微处理器的结合使用:
STM32是由STMicroelectronics(意法半导体)生产的一系列32位ARM Cortex-M微控制器,广泛应用于嵌入式系统开发。而8051是一个较为经典的8位微控制器系列,由英特尔于1980年推出。在本项目中,尽管标题提到了8051,但是基于实际的项目内容描述,更可能是以STM32微控制器为核心,使用8051的编程或设计思想来进行开发。这表明项目可能涉及在Protues仿真环境中模拟STM32的运行状态,同时可能在软件层面采用了与8051相关的编程逻辑或特性。
2. Protues仿真软件:
Protues是英国Labcenter Electronics公司开发的一款电路仿真软件,广泛应用于电子设计自动化(EDA)领域。它可以用于模拟微处理器、微控制器、数字和模拟电路等。本项目使用Protues软件进行仿真,意味着它提供了一个低成本、高效率的学习和开发平台,可以帮助开发者在没有实际硬件的情况下,测试和调试项目代码。
3. 电子钟项目开发:
电子钟项目可能涉及到嵌入式系统开发的基础知识,包括但不限于时间的读取与控制、显示设备的驱动(如LCD或LED显示)、按钮或触摸屏等输入设备的处理、定时器的使用以及可能的温度补偿算法。这个项目可能包含硬件设计、固件编程、以及可能的PCB布线等方面的内容。
4. 适用人群与附加价值:
项目描述中提到适用于希望学习不同技术领域的小白或进阶学习者。这表明项目的源码将对初学者友好,可能会有详细的文档和注释。项目还特别适用于需要作为毕业设计、课程设计或工程实训的学生,因为它不仅提供了可以直接运行的代码,还鼓励用户在此基础上进行修改和功能扩展。这样既保证了学习的连贯性,也为有基础的学习者提供了更深入研究和创新的机会。
5. 技术栈涉及的领域:
源代码列表中提到的技术栈包括ST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、python、web、C#、EDA、proteus、RTOS等,这些技术覆盖了硬件开发、移动开发、操作系统、编程语言、前后端开发等多个领域。因此,项目的源代码可以作为学习和实践这些技术的一个很好的起点。
6. 硬件开发工具链:
在硬件开发领域,本项目可能会用到一些常用的开发工具,例如ST的STM32CubeMX配置工具、Keil MDK或IAR Embedded Workbench等集成开发环境。这些工具对于编写、编译、下载和调试STM32程序至关重要。
7. 项目资源:
资源可能包括源代码文件、固件编译后的二进制文件、Protues仿真文件(如*.dsn文件),可能还会有硬件设计文件,例如电路原理图和PCB布局文件。这些资源的提供可以帮助用户全面理解项目的每一个部分,并快速入门和深入学习。
8. 沟通交流与用户支持:
项目描述中强调了开放沟通的态度,这意味着学习者在使用项目资源时遇到问题可以及时得到解答,并且鼓励用户之间的互相学习和交流,共同提高。
总结而言,本项目“基于STM32的Protues仿真实例(8051)-电子钟.zip”是一个综合性很强的学习资源,覆盖了从硬件开发到软件编程的多个方面,对有志于在嵌入式系统领域深入学习和实践的个人或学生来说,是一个非常有价值的学习工具。通过这个项目,学习者不仅可以掌握电子钟的设计和开发流程,而且可以在这个基础上扩展和创新,实现更为复杂的功能。
2021-03-23 上传
2022-06-24 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
CrMylive.
- 粉丝: 1w+
- 资源: 4万+
最新资源
- SSM动力电池数据管理系统源码及数据库详解
- R语言桑基图绘制与SCI图输入文件代码分析
- Linux下Sakagari Hurricane翻译工作:cpktools的使用教程
- prettybench: 让 Go 基准测试结果更易读
- Python官方文档查询库,提升开发效率与时间节约
- 基于Django的Python就业系统毕设源码
- 高并发下的SpringBoot与Nginx+Redis会话共享解决方案
- 构建问答游戏:Node.js与Express.js实战教程
- MATLAB在旅行商问题中的应用与优化方法研究
- OMAPL138 DSP平台UPP接口编程实践
- 杰克逊维尔非营利地基工程的VMS项目介绍
- 宠物猫企业网站模板PHP源码下载
- 52简易计算器源码解析与下载指南
- 探索Node.js v6.2.1 - 事件驱动的高性能Web服务器环境
- 找回WinSCP密码的神器:winscppasswd工具介绍
- xctools:解析Xcode命令行工具输出的Ruby库